Certified Refurbished vs. Seller Refurbished: Key Differences
Are refurbished electronics a good deal when considering Certified Refurbished versus Seller Refurbished options?
Certified Refurbished products undergo rigorous testing and come with manufacturer-backed warranties, ensuring higher quality and reliability. Seller Refurbished items are restored by individual sellers with varying standards and often lack official guarantees, making them less predictable purchases.
Common Myths About Refurbished Electronics Debunked
Myth | Reality |
---|---|
Refurbished Electronics Are Always Defective | Refurbished devices undergo rigorous testing and repairs to meet manufacturer standards, ensuring they function like new. |
Refurbished Products Lack Warranty | Many refurbished electronics come with warranties or guarantees, often ranging from 90 days to one year, providing consumer protection. |
Refurbished Means Used or Old Stock | Refurbished items can include returned products, open-box devices, or repaired units, which are inspected and restored before resale. |
Refurbished Electronics Have Lower Performance | Performance of refurbished electronics is maintained or enhanced through repairs and component replacements when necessary. |
Refurbished Items Are Not Environmentally Friendly | Purchasing refurbished electronics reduces e-waste and promotes sustainable consumption by extending product lifecycles. |

Trusted Sources: How to Choose Reliable Refurbished Electronics Sellers
Choosing reliable refurbished electronics sellers is essential to ensure product quality and warranty coverage. Trusted sources such as certified refurbishers and manufacturer-backed platforms offer rigorous testing and genuine parts.
Look for sellers with strong customer reviews, clear return policies, and transparent refurbishment processes. Platforms like Apple Certified Refurbished, Best Buy Outlet, and Amazon Renewed provide buyer protection and verified product conditions.
